The HBCU Connect Scholarship Basics
HBCUCONNECT.COM is proud to offer the 2010 HBCUCONNECT.COM Scholarship Program for HBCU students. The 2010 program makes available several $1,000.00 scholarships for up to 4 minority applicants who attend or plan to attend an HBCU college or university. The scholarship can be applied to tuition or books for the 2010 Summer or Fall semester.

HBCU CONNECT as an organization is the largest student and alumni organization of Historically Black College and University supporters in history. Founded in 1999, we have given away thousands in scholarship dollars to deserving college students. We are dedicated to keeping HBCU students and graduates connected with each other and with opportunities for advancement.

We raise and disburse scholarship funds from our non-profit arm "The HBCU Foundation, Inc." which is a certified 501c(3) organization.

Who's Eligible:
  1. Students enrolled or planning to enroll into any Historically Black College or University for Summer or Fall of 2010.
  2. All Graduating High School Seniors or Transfer students, and Current HBCU students must show proof of enrollment.
  3. Minorities - African American, Hispanic, and Native American.

Disbursement:
Scholarships are awarded to recipients for one academic year. The scholarship will cover up to $1000.00 of the student's tuition for the current academic year as posted by the financial aid office of the university or college. The scholarships are made through the designated school and are not transferable to other academic institutions. The funds are to be used for tuition only and may not be used for other costs on the recipient's bursar bill.

HBCUCONNECT.COM will review all online registrations and select final candidates on the basis of:
  • Eligibility
  • Quality of content
  • Resume
  • Objectives
  • Accomplishments
  • Financial Need
